SB17-218

Sunset Continue Licensing Of Landscape Architects

Concerning the continuation of the regulation of landscape architects by the division of professions and occupations in the department of regulatory agencies.

Bill Summary

Sunset Process - Senate Business, Labor, and Technology Committee. The bill implements one of the two recommendations contained in the department of regulatory agencies' (department) sunset report on the regulation of landscape architects by the division of professions and occupations, including the state board of landscape architects (board).

Sections 1 and 2 of the bill implement recommendation 1 of the sunset report to continue the licensing of landscape architects for 11 years, until 2028.
